Im Juli wurde der Kalender umfassend überarbeitet. Aus Kundenperspektive ist das ein wichtiger Schritt: Termine und Ereignisse sollen nicht „irgendwie funktionieren“, sondern sauber kategorisiert, schnell angelegt und verlässlich aktualisiert werden.
Was wurde umgesetzt
- Calendar Rework (umfangreiche Serie an Commits).
- Default- und Custom-Kategorien: anzeigen, erstellen, bearbeiten, filtern.
- Drag-and-Drop für Termine, verbessertes Styling, bessere Interaktion.
- CreateCalendarEventDialog + Differenzierung zwischen Day-Click und Time-Click.
- Info-Modal für Termine, Snackbar-Notifications, Error-Handling.
- APIs/Endpoints für Kategorien, Events, Appointment by ID, Invalidations bei CRUD.
- Sidebar-Verbesserungen (scrollbar, toggle, create button).
- Release-Stand 22.07 / 24.07 plus Bugfixes (Task-Form, Worktime-Edit Jahr).
Warum das wichtig ist
Kunden wollen im Kalender nicht nur „sehen“, sondern arbeiten: schnell anlegen, sauber sortieren, individuell kategorisieren, mobil gut bedienbar.
Kundenvorteil
- Mehr Übersicht durch Kategorien & Filter.
- Schnelleres Planen durch bessere Erstellung und Interaktion.
- Weniger Fehler durch bessere Rückmeldungen (Snackbars) und robustere Datenflüsse.
- Besser mobil nutzbar durch UI-Anpassungen.
Fazit: Juli bringt Kalender-Funktionalität auf ein Level, das echte Planung unterstützt – ein klarer Wunsch aus dem Kundenalltag.